Welcome to ACM Groupsite - ACM's Online Community!
ACM Groupsite is the Association of Children's Museums' central hub online. It's a space where children's museum staff, stakeholders, and partners can view upcoming events from ACM, network with other children's museum professionals, and ask for advice, share ideas, and access resources on our discussion boards.
